Here’s a story, and you don’t have to visit many
houses to find it. One person is talking,
the other one is not really listening.
Someone can look like they are but they’re
actually thinking about something they
want to say, or their minds are just
wandering. Or they’re looking at that
little box people hold in their hands these
days. And people get discouraged, so they
quit trying. And the very quiet people,
you may have noticed, are often the sad
people.

About Mary Oliver

Mary Jane Oliver (10 September 1935 – 17 January 2019) was an American poet who won the National Book Award and the Pulitzer Prize.
